The mission of REACH Center after-school program is to provide at-risk youth a safe, secure place of refuge, study and edification through structured programs and activities designed to meet the needs of each individual enabling them to tap into their potential, discover talents and gifts, reach for their dreams, graduate high school, go on to higher education and become productive members of society.

REACH Center Youth Program will have the following programs and activities:

  • The REACH for your homework after-school program consisting of homework assistance, a tutoring program and an in-depth interactive educational computer program
  • The REACH for a book reading program
  • Case Management
  • Weekly Workshops and Awareness Groups
  • Enrichment program
  • Gang prevention/intervention program
  • Mentoring program
  • Job readiness training in conjunction with a career search and summer job program
  • Positive Life Preparations program
  • GED classes/testing
